ID ANNOUNCES 46th FUGITIVE IN CUSTODY FEATURED ON "IN PURSUIT WITH JOHN WALSH"

(New York, N.Y.) - Six days after the Season 4 finale of IN PURSUIT WITH JOHN WALSH, fugitive Alex Bennett from Baltimore, Maryland, was captured after months of being on the run. Bennett made his national appearance on the finale episode, titled "Last Ride," which aired on November 9, 2022 and was arrested on November 15, 2022. Bennett is wanted for allegedly raping a child in 2020. The tip that came in after the show aired helped authorities develop his location further, and ultimately led to the arrest of Alex Bennett. The United States Marshals said Bennett was arrested on the east coast by Deputies from the District of Maryland's Silver Shield unit, supported by the Capital Area Regional Fugitive Task Force. Authorities confirm Bennett was taken to the Central Booking and Intake Center in Baltimore, Maryland.

Bennett was the most recent fugitive featured on IN PURSUIT WITH JOHN WALSH in a segment titled "15 Seconds of Shame" - one of the most powerful tools in John Walsh's arsenal to bring awareness to additional fugitives in the show. Bennett marks the 46th fugitive who has been featured on IN PURSUIT found or in custody.

ABOUT IN PURSUIT WITH JOHN WALSH

John Walsh joins Investigation Discovery on their joint mission to track down fugitives on the run and find missing children with IN PURSUIT WITH JOHN WALSH. Each week, John Walsh leads viewers through unsolved violent crimes that urgently need to be closed - where time is of the essence and vigilant viewers could bring these criminals to justice. Joining John in every episode is his son, Callahan Walsh, who leads the operation on the ground, working in tandem with the community and local authorities to search for persons-of-interest. In partnership with the National Center for Missing & Exploited Children (NCMEC), the series will also feature two missing children each hour, providing age-progression photos and descriptions in the hopes that viewers can provide new leads to their whereabouts.

Investigation Discovery is tapping into its uniquely engaged audience to help track down these persons of interest. An active call center at 1-833-3-PURSUE and dedicated online hub at InPursuitTips.com are staffed by trained English and Spanish-speaking operators, who accept anonymous tips and alert the proper authorities.
